Air India pilot couldn't give urine sample for dope test, probe officer helped him: Report

The pilot of Air India's Phuket-Delhi flight, which dropped 300 feet mid-air, appeared unsteady and needed assistance to sit down after landing in Delhi, NDTV reported. An investigating officer physically helped the pilot while he provided his urine sample, the report noted. Additionally, he wasn't in his seat inside the cockpit when the aircraft plunged, leaving the co-pilot in command.
